Puppy Primer: Essential Training for Your Little Furball

Bringing home a new puppy is like welcoming pure happiness into your life! They're precious, but they also need guidance to grow into well-adjusted canines. This primer will give you the fundamentals for training your little furball and setting them up for a lifetime of love.

  • Start potty training early! Consistency is crucial.
  • Introduce your puppy to many sights, sounds, and humans.
  • Show basic commands like sit, stay, and come. Keep lessons short and fun.

Don't forget that patience is a necessity when it comes to puppy training. Celebrate achievements along the way and enjoy this special time with your new furry companion.

Effective Steps to a Well-Behaved Dog: Training Tips that lead to Success

Raising a well-behaved dog requires patience and consistency. Starting with the basics is key. Teach your pup basic commands like sit, stay, come, and leave it using positive reinforcement methods such as treats and praise. Persistence in training sessions will help your dog learn faster and build their obedience skills. Make sure to introduce your dog to different people, places, and environments to build their confidence and reduce anxiety.

  • Look into a puppy training class to learn from experienced trainers and socialize with other dogs.
  • Provide your dog gets plenty of physical and mental stimulation through walks, playtime, and enriching toys.
  • Address any behavioral problems promptly and constructively to prevent them from worsening.

Remember that every dog is different, so be patient, tailor your training methods as needed, and most importantly, have fun bonding with your furry friend!
